HCONRES 78 United States House · 118th Congress

Expressing the sense of Congress that public health professionals should be commended for their dedication and service to the United States on Public Health Thank You Day, November 20, 2023.

HCONRES 78 is a symbolic resolution expressing Congress's recognition of public health professionals' contributions. It urges the nation to commend these workers on Public Health Thank You Day (November 20, 2023), highlighting their roles in disease prevention, maternal health, mental health support, and addressing health disparities. The resolution does not create new laws or funding but formally acknowledges their service through a non-binding statement. It directly affects public health professionals by publicly affirming their value to national health and safety. This is a ceremonial gesture with no concrete policy changes or legal effect.
